Baked "fried" Potatoes

INGREDIENTS

2 Baking potatoes
1 T Olive oil
1/2 t Paprika
1/4 t Salt

INSTRUCTIONS

Scrub 2 large (8-10 oz) baking potatoes. Cut each in half lengthwise.
Cut each half into 4 spears.  Place potatoes in large pot of lightly
salted boiling water, bring water back to boil and boil 3 minutes.
Drain in colander.  Spray cooking sheet with cooking spray.  Mix 1
Tablespoon olive oil and potatoes in bowl.  Mix 1/2 teaspoon paprika
and 1/4 teaspoon salt together, toss over  potatoes.  Mix well.  Bake
in preheated 400 oven for 15 minutes or until tender.  Place in paper
towel lined basket or bowl.  Toss gently with 1  tablespoon graded
Parmesan Cheese.  Serve hot.  Makes 2 servings Can add other spices to
salt mixture for different  flavors.  ==  Courtesy of Dale & Gail
